Health & Beauty

Spas near Dagohoy Street, Baguio City, Philippines - Page 3

 
Showing 21 - 22 of 22

Spa De Sloeil
Spas

Approximately 1.55 KM away

Address : 144, EDY Building Fourth Floor, Kisad Road, Baguio, 2600 Benguet, Philippines

Sparadise Baguio
Spas

Approximately 1.67 KM away

Address : #15, 2nd Road, Quezon Hill, Baguio City, Benguet 2600, Philippines